1 Effective Technical Presentations

2 A presentation is story telling

3 Organizing Your Ideas Be clear about what the story-line is Remember a story has a BEGINNING – MIDDLE – END Use an outline to help keep you organized Don’t leave your audience behind

4 Know your audience What do they know? What do they want? What do YOU want then to know? What do they expect?

5 Put it on paper Use an outline - not a full text Don’t Read the text

6 Say that again Use repetition Say it more than one way

7 Body language Yes, you can use your hands! Please don’t play with your keys Let the audience see your enthusiasm for the subject

8 Some Graphics are Worth a Thousand Words some others…. fuggetaboutit Visible Simple Understandable Relevant

9 Too busy!

10 No jaggy images

11 Do not distort

12 Converse with Your Audience Remember that a presentation is a two way conversation Look at your audience to establish the connection Pay attention to what the audience is saying to you
